Overview

Position: Occupational Therapist (OT)

Location: Macon, GA

Schedule: PRN/Per Diem - Week Days Only 

Compensation: $55.00 per hour

Sign-On Bonus: $5,000

 

Regency Hospital - Macon is a critical illness recovery hospital committed to providing world-class inpatient post-ICU services to chronic, critically ill patients who require extended healing and recovery. We help patients during some of the most vulnerable, painful moments of their lives – and Occupational Therapists (OT) play a central role in providing compassionate, excellent treatment every step of the way.

Responsibilities

  • Participate in discharge planning for each patient, including placement, patient/family education and adaptive equipment
  • Supervise certified occupational therapy assistants (OTAs), as well as OT and COTA students
  • Conduct individual patient therapy regimens
  • Monitor patients’ responses to treatment
  • Participate in continuing education seminars and in-services

Qualifications

Minimum Qualifications

  • Current state licensure as an Occupational Therapist required.
  • Certified BLS or completion in first 90 days of employment required.
